lesson number three which is actually about the fullbacks more specifically Joe scall but I'm going to talk about the fullbacks lesson number three again about the fullbacks but more specifically on the right back position we already know that Anthony Robinson is the locked in left back right we know that but then right back we see some debates between dest and scall and here's what I'm going to say sergino dest is as big of a lock to be our right back when healthy when he's back from the Tor ACL as much as Robinson is our locked in left back and this is not a jab on Joe scall to me he is a roster lock but he's just a very reliable defensive backup right back he doesn't offer anything on the buildout and he doesn't offer anything in the final third Serino D is at times a defensive liability but this guy can help us on combination play creativity long shots beat players on one beat one the technical ability of D is too much ahead of scall for him to be a backup to scall now sure if you need maybe to hold a result late in the game you replace death with scall but most of the time or 99.9% of the time if healthy it has to be sergino Des starting the gap between them defensively is not that big on offense or on the the ball in general even on the buildout it's huge now in terms of the backup left back it's still up for grabs Robinson is the locked in starter he's not in Camp right now obviously lond didn't convince me maybe give Caleb Wy a shot against New Zealand I don't know but as of now to me and this will probably be the way it'll go till 2026 if they are healthy des and aob are Lux to start in the fullback position lesson number four is that the ghost of Greg burh halter is still haunting this team and Jesse Marsh called it out and this is what Marsh said and these are his words not mine our players know the US pretty well by our players he's obviously referring to Canada two so then he said I had anticipated that Mikey Mikey VZ with Greg berhalter being a big influence for him would play a similar style of football or soccer we were able to craft a match plan to deal with some of those things and we executed it really well and all of that was quite evident so no this loss is not on Greg burh halter but his ghost and his legacy is still haunting us you know the one that this clown left the US Men's National Team with vadas went all burh halter ball invited Canada to set up the Press we kept passing the ball around with the center backs we wouldn't pass it into Midfield once the Press was set up Rema Richards would find one of the midfielders that would trigger the Press right it would be Johnny or Musa they would get hacked lose the ball they had plenty of bad G giveaways and so did Tim Rene when he tried to complete a few passes it's on the players but also on the dumbass coach that is married to the same old crap burh halter system we played bur halter ball the team looked slow in possession with no passion soulless just like we did over the summer and one thing pochettino needs to get it right this team doesn't have a very technical backline right let's just make that clear and the goalkeepers also not good at his feet so it's very complicated to play out of the back and we tried once again with Mikey vdas to play out of the back with these players with the players that we have if you want to play out of the back the tactics the positioning and the reading of the game from the players has to be near perfect because otherwise you will see all these bad giveaways when You Face a good press in Canada specifically because of Jesse Marsh and the players that they have they're a good pressing team and it worked wonders in their 442 midblock essentially we need a coach that's not an imbecile which
